Game libraries at these sites are noticeably bigger. UKGC-licensed casinos have to certify every slot and table game through approved testing labs, which slows down releases by weeks. International casinos skip some of that red tape, so new titles from studios like Pragmatic Play, Hacksaw Gaming, and Nolimit City land faster – often with higher max win caps than their UK versions.
